From neamh- (negative prefix) +‎ fuil, fola (blood) + -ach (adjectival suffix).

Adjective

[edit]

neamhfholach (genitive singular masculine neamhfholaigh, genitive singular feminine neamhfholaí, plural neamhfholacha, comparative neamhfholaí)

  1. bloodless, anaemic
